Mao Tang is a scholar working on Materials Chemistry, Mechanical Engineering and Ceramics and Composites. According to data from OpenAlex, Mao Tang has authored 21 papers receiving a total of 476 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Materials Chemistry, 6 papers in Mechanical Engineering and 4 papers in Ceramics and Composites. Recurrent topics in Mao Tang’s work include Advanced ceramic materials synthesis (4 papers), Aluminum Alloys Composites Properties (3 papers) and Advanced Photocatalysis Techniques (3 papers). Mao Tang is often cited by papers focused on Advanced ceramic materials synthesis (4 papers), Aluminum Alloys Composites Properties (3 papers) and Advanced Photocatalysis Techniques (3 papers). Mao Tang collaborates with scholars based in China, United States and Italy. Mao Tang's co-authors include Yun Liu, Chenglong Lin, Yusi Peng, Jian Lü and Xuejian Liu and has published in prestigious journals such as Physical Review B, The Science of The Total Environment and Earth and Planetary Science Letters.
